Description
Photograph of a drawing of the west end of Mission San Gabriel, ca.1876. A buggy sits at the far left corner, by the side of a large house-like structure, which stretches across the shot to the right, where a fence is sketched in. Beside the fence sits a tumble of foliage, and more trees can be seen behind the house, at left.

Description
The nearly 15,000 unique photographs of this collection contain the work of C.C. Pierce which cover the Los Angeles region city, street and architectural views, California Missions, Southwestern Native Americans, and turn-of-century Nevada, Arizona, and California. Pierce, active from 1886 to 1940, was one of the leading photographers of his day and amassed a collection of 15,000 images, including his own and those bought and copied from his contemporaries, George Wharton James and Charles Puck. The James collection contains over 2,000 images of portraits, customs, ceremonies, arts, and games of various groups of Southwestern Native Americans.
